POSITION SUMMARY:
As the Office & Administrative Coordinator, you are the first point of contact at Mattr, playing a vital role in creating a welcoming and professional first impression. You are responsible for greeting and directing guests and visiting employees, ensuring a seamless and positive experience. In this role, you will manage front desk operations, including handling incoming and outgoing mail and couriers, maintaining an organized and presentable reception area, coordinating bank deposits, and overseeing file room organization. You will also perform a range of administrative tasks such as data entry, word processing, and general office support. Beyond daily operations, you will support and coordinate internal events such as luncheons, barbecues, company tours, employee recognition events, and training sessions—helping foster a positive, engaging, and inclusive workplace culture.
DUTIES:
Executive & Administrative Support
- Provide comprehensive administrative support to the Group President, including:
-Completing expense reports and processing invoices.
-Arranging complex travel plans, itineraries, agendas, and compiling materials for meetings and events. - Monitor and track vacation requests and approvals.
- Process online bank deposits and support financial documentation.
- Prepare inter-office memos, draft purchase orders, and assist with process documentation and improvement.
Meetings, Event & Travel Coordination
- Coordinate internal and external meetings, including venue selection, catering, audiovisual needs, and agenda preparation.
- Organize internal events such as team-building sessions, sales meetings, customer tours/lunches, and employee recognition functions.
- Facilitate travel arrangements for Executive. Arrange accomodations for visiting employees when needed.
- Support logistics for executive representation at industry events, social functions, and internal staff gatherings.
Office & Facilities Management
- Oversee daily management of the hoteling system for cubicle and office space allocation.
- Order and maintain office equipment and supplies to support daily operations.
- Serve as a point of contact with internal teams and administrative assistants to resolve office-related inquiries efficiently."
Mailroom, Courier & Document Handling
- Manage all mailroom functions, including:
-Sorting and distributing incoming mail.
-Sending outgoing packages via courier and coordinating with external vendors for timely deliveries.
-Maintaining the postage meter and ensuring account accuracy."
Visitor & Stakeholder Engagement
- Greet guests courteously and ensure adherence to visitor procedures and safety protocols.
- Serve as a communication liaison with external customers, vendors, and stakeholders.
- Support cross-divisional coordination by facilitating outreach and travel plans."
REQUIREMENTS:
- Minimum 2-3 years experience in similar role.
- Strong experience in managing administrative tasks.
- Strong experience in coordinating different types of events.
- Previous experience in Hospitality - preferred.
- Proficient in Microsoft Office applications, including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ook, and SharePoint - Must.
- Experience with additional software such as Concur, IFS, and Adobe - Asset.
- Strong internet research abilities and project coordination/administration skills.
- Minimum College education and any administration courses, preferred.
- Ability to work fully onsite from our facility in Vaughan, ON.
- A valid driver’s license is required to support occasional travel for company events, off-site meetings, and other business-related activities.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
- Exceptional attention to detail and accuracy.
- Proactive with strong planning skills, particularly in anticipating and preparing for events in the corporate cycle.
- Sound decision-making skills within a defined span of control.
- Strong problem-solving capabilities.
- Proven organizational skills with the ability to multi-task, prioritize effectively, and meet de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
- High ethical standards and integrity, with demonstrated discretion in handling confidential and sensitive information.
- Ability to work independently under pressure and adapt quickly to shifting priorities.
- Professional demeanor and approachable attitude with the ability to build strong relationships across all levels of the organization and with external stakeholders.
- Capable of serving as a liaison between senior executives and internal/external contacts.
- Willingness and flexibility to work outside standard business hours as required.
